The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) conducts this test every year. Teachers need this certificate to work in classes 1 to 8 across India. The exam has two papers. Paper 1 is for teachers who want to teach classes 1 to 5. Paper 2 is for those who want to teach classes 6 to 8. Each paper takes 150 minutes to complete. Subject-Wise Study Material Guide

Each subject in the CTET exam needs special attention. Here's what you should focus on for each area:

Child Development and Pedagogy

This subject appears in both papers and carries 30 marks. The topics include how children learn and grow, different learning theories, and teaching methods.

Important theories to study include Piaget's stages of development, Vygotsky's social learning theory, and Kohlberg's moral development theory. These concepts help you understand how children think and learn at different ages.

Good CTET study material for this subject should explain these theories in simple terms. Look for books that give real-life examples of how these theories work in classrooms.

Language Subjects

Both papers include two language sections. Usually, one is Hindi or English, and the other is a regional language or English.

The language sections test your understanding of grammar, reading comprehension, and teaching methods. The questions are not too difficult, but you need to practice regularly.

Focus on unseen passages, as they carry good marks. Practice reading different types of texts and answering questions about them. This improves both your language skills and test-taking ability.

Mathematics (Paper 1)

Mathematics in Paper 1 covers basic topics like numbers, add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, fractions, and geometry. The level is elementary, but you need to know how to teach these concepts to young children.

Study materials should include both content knowledge and pedagogy. You need to understand mathematical concepts and know different ways to explain them to students.

Environmental Studies (Paper 1)

Environmental Studies combines science and social studies topics. It covers themes like family, food, shelter, water, and travel. The subject focuses on the world around us and how we interact with it.

Good study materials for EVS should connect different topics and show how they relate to daily life. Practice questions that ask you to apply environmental concepts to real situations.

Science and Social Studies (Paper 2)

If you choose Science for Paper 2, focus on basic concepts from physics, chemistry, and biology. The level is secondary school standard. Social Studies covers history, geography, political science, and economics.

Both subjects include pedagogy questions about teaching methods, assessment techniques, and classroom management. Make sure your study materials cover both content and teaching approaches.

Making the Most of Previous Year Papers

Working with ctet previous year question paper book requires a strategy. Don't just solve papers randomly. Follow these steps:

Start with Analysis

Before solving papers, asses them to understand question patterns, difficulty levels, and important topics. This helps you focus your preparation better.

Time Management Practice

Solve papers within the actual exam time limit. This builds your speed and helps you manage time during the real exam.

Learn from Mistakes

After solving each paper, carefully review your mistakes. Understand why you got questions wrong and how to avoid similar errors.

The drill books work best when you set a strong target. For each set of 25 items:

  1. Finish in 20 minutes.

  2. Mark the correct answers right away.

  3. Classify misses by root cause: fast guess, half-known fact, or sheer blank.

  4. Write each miss plus its fix in the diary.

At the end of each week, read the diary pages. They show exact topics to revisit in the core CTET book on Monday morning.

Avoid in CTET Preparation Books

Learning from others' mistakes can save you time and effort:

Relying on Too Many Sources

Using too many different books and materials can create confusion. Stick to a few good sources and study them thoroughly.

Ignoring Pedagogy Sections

Many candidates focus only on subject content and ignore pedagogy. Remember that teaching methods and child psychology are equally important.

Skipping Mock Tests

Some students spend all their time reading and never practice with full-length tests. Mock tests are essential for building exam confidence and time management skills.
